CC   -!- FUNCTION: Participates in the degradation of poly-3-hydroxybutyrate
CC       (PHB). It works downstream of poly(3-hydroxybutyrate) depolymerase,
CC       hydrolyzing D(-)-3-hydroxybutyrate oligomers of various length (3HB-
CC       oligomers) into 3HB-monomers. {ECO:0000255|HAMAP-Rule:MF_01906}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=(3R)-hydroxybutanoate dimer + H2O = 2 (R)-3-hydroxybutanoate +
CC         H(+); Xref=Rhea:RHEA:10172, ChEBI:CHEBI:10979, ChEBI:CHEBI:10983,
CC         ChEBI:CHEBI:15377, ChEBI:CHEBI:15378; EC=3.1.1.22;
CC         Evidence={ECO:0000255|HAMAP-Rule:MF_01906};
CC   -!- PATHWAY: Lipid metabolism; butanoate metabolism. {ECO:0000255|HAMAP-
CC       Rule:MF_01906}.
CC   -!- SUBCELLULAR LOCATION: Secreted {ECO:0000255|HAMAP-Rule:MF_01906}.
CC   -!- SIMILARITY: Belongs to the D-(-)-3-hydroxybutyrate oligomer hydrolase
CC       family. {ECO:0000255|HAMAP-Rule:MF_01906}.
